Manchester Choral Society Second Annual Integrated Arts Conference & Children's Arts Festival
Friday, March 13, 2020
8:30-3:00pm
Manchester Community Music School
2291 Elm Street, Manchester NH

Cost: $95 includes workshops, conference materials, lunch for teachers and student registration fee (students will bring a bag lunch)

***Students do not pay a separate fee for this chorus festival, it is included in  the teacher participation fee***

Themes: Hope, resilience, inclusion and empathy through Arts Integration and SEL
PD Hours: Earn 8 hours of Professional Development.
Children’s Art Festival: Students in Grades 4-8, Krystal Morin, Chorus Conductor and Visual Art and Theatre Activities!
